How Common Is The Last Name Frosh?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 737,137th most widespread surname world-wide It is held by around 1 in 18,590,678 people. The surname Frosh is mostly found in The Americas, where 47 percent of Frosh reside; 46 percent reside in North America and 46 percent reside in Anglo-North America. It is also the 3,684,242nd most frequently held first name in the world, borne by 10 people.
It is most commonly held in The United States, where it is held by 176 people, or 1 in 2,059,426. In The United States it is primarily concentrated in: Ohio, where 21 percent are found, Colorado, where 18 percent are found and Washington, where 10 percent are found. Outside of The United States Frosh exists in 18 countries. It is also common in Pakistan, where 23 percent are found and Australia, where 6 percent are found.
Frosh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Frosh has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Frosh surname rose 160 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it rose 106 percent between 1881 and 2014.
